Lisa Bobet

Lisa is a novelist, poet, editor, and active community organiser (urban agriculture and food sovereignty) based in Toronto, Ontario, Canada. Her novel-length work has won Canada’s Prix Aurora Award, Sunburst Award, Copper Cylinder Award, and been noted on the Canadian Library Association and Ontario Library Association’s best of the year lists; it’s also been nominated for SFWA’s Andre Norton Award and the SFPA’s Rhysling. As poetry editor alongside fiction editor Cecile Cristofari, our 2021 issue of Reckoning: creative writing on environmental justice’s focused on climate work rooted in joy and won the Utopia Award. Lisa has also been a contest reader for Grist’s 2022 Imagine 2200 climate fiction contest, hosted festival stages, and taught workshops for young adult and adult writers from Canada and the US to New Zealand and Ireland.
